我想用mathematics做出这样的函数图形我想实现在频率f=2KHz,E=3V方波下to=22*10^(-6);当取正值的时候Uc(t)=E*(1-Exp[-t/to]),负值的时候取Uc(t)=E*Exp[-t/to];做出这样的Uc(t)在t在-5to到5to时间内的函数图像在mat
来源:学生作业帮助网 编辑:作业帮 时间:2024/07/06 13:10:45
![我想用mathematics做出这样的函数图形我想实现在频率f=2KHz,E=3V方波下to=22*10^(-6);当取正值的时候Uc(t)=E*(1-Exp[-t/to]),负值的时候取Uc(t)=E*Exp[-t/to];做出这样的Uc(t)在t在-5to到5to时间内的函数图像在mat](/uploads/image/z/8812046-38-6.jpg?t=%E6%88%91%E6%83%B3%E7%94%A8mathematics%E5%81%9A%E5%87%BA%E8%BF%99%E6%A0%B7%E7%9A%84%E5%87%BD%E6%95%B0%E5%9B%BE%E5%BD%A2%E6%88%91%E6%83%B3%E5%AE%9E%E7%8E%B0%E5%9C%A8%E9%A2%91%E7%8E%87f%3D2KHz%2CE%3D3V%E6%96%B9%E6%B3%A2%E4%B8%8Bto%3D22%2A10%5E%28-6%29%3B%E5%BD%93%E5%8F%96%E6%AD%A3%E5%80%BC%E7%9A%84%E6%97%B6%E5%80%99Uc%28t%29%3DE%2A%281-Exp%5B-t%2Fto%5D%29%2C%E8%B4%9F%E5%80%BC%E7%9A%84%E6%97%B6%E5%80%99%E5%8F%96Uc%28t%29%3DE%2AExp%5B-t%2Fto%5D%3B%E5%81%9A%E5%87%BA%E8%BF%99%E6%A0%B7%E7%9A%84Uc%28t%29%E5%9C%A8t%E5%9C%A8-5to%E5%88%B05to%E6%97%B6%E9%97%B4%E5%86%85%E7%9A%84%E5%87%BD%E6%95%B0%E5%9B%BE%E5%83%8F%E5%9C%A8mat)
我想用mathematics做出这样的函数图形我想实现在频率f=2KHz,E=3V方波下to=22*10^(-6);当取正值的时候Uc(t)=E*(1-Exp[-t/to]),负值的时候取Uc(t)=E*Exp[-t/to];做出这样的Uc(t)在t在-5to到5to时间内的函数图像在mat
我想用mathematics做出这样的函数图形
我想实现在频率f=2KHz,E=3V方波下to=22*10^(-6);当取正值的时候Uc(t)=E*(1-Exp[-t/to]),负值的时候取Uc(t)=E*Exp[-t/to];做出这样的Uc(t)在t在-5to到5to时间内的函数图像在mathematics5.02要如何书写?能不能将上述的周期函数带入Uc(t)的表达式一起表示?
我想用mathematics做出这样的函数图形我想实现在频率f=2KHz,E=3V方波下to=22*10^(-6);当取正值的时候Uc(t)=E*(1-Exp[-t/to]),负值的时候取Uc(t)=E*Exp[-t/to];做出这样的Uc(t)在t在-5to到5to时间内的函数图像在mat
希望下面是你要的结果.f = 2*^3; e = 3; t0 = 22*^-6; Uc[t_] := If[Mod[2 (t*f),2] < 1,e*(1 - Exp[-Mod[2 (t*f),2]/f/t0]),e*(Exp[-(Mod[2 (t*f),2] - 1)/f/t0])]; Ua[t_] := If[Mod[2 (t*f),2] < 1,e,-e]; tu[1] = Plot[{Ua[t]},{t,-5 t0,5 t0},PlotStyle -> Blue] tu[2] = Plot[{Uc[t]},{t,-5 t0,5 t0},PlotStyle -> Green] Show[tu[1],tu[2]] 上面是你要的结果:不过如果是充放电的过程的话,你的t0好像太大了,以至于{t,-5 t0,5 t0},实际上还不到一个周期,如果你将程序改成下面的样子就可以看到整个周期的图象了,f = 2*^3; e = 3; t0 = 22*^-6; Uc[t_] := If[Mod[2 (t*f),2] < 1,e*(1 - Exp[-Mod[2 (t*f),2]/f/t0]),e*(Exp[-(Mod[2 (t*f),2] - 1)/f/t0])]; Ua[t_] := If[Mod[2 (t*f),2] < 1,e,-e]; tu[1] = Plot[{Ua[t]},{t,0,1/f},PlotStyle -> Blue] tu[2] = Plot[{Uc[t]},{t,0,1/f},PlotStyle -> Green] Show[tu[1],tu[2]]